Oracle Golden Gate和Oracle Active Data Guard在Oracle中的区别
Oracle Golden Gate和Oracle Active Data Guard都是数据复制技术。它们都用于数据复制,但策略不同。
根据Oracle文档:
Oracle Active Data Guard通过在远程位置维护生产副本的精确物理副本(在复制活动时为只读),以最简单、最经济的方式为Oracle数据库提供最佳的数据保护和可用性。
GoldenGate是一款高级逻辑复制产品,支持多主复制、星型部署和数据转换,为客户提供非常灵活的选择,以满足各种复制需求。GoldenGate还支持各种异构硬件平台和数据库管理系统之间的复制。
序号 | 关键点 | Oracle Golden Gate | Oracle Data Guard |
---|---|---|---|
1 | 基础 | 数据复制仅限于异构数据库平台 | 数据复制仅限于同构数据库平台 |
2 | 数据复制 | 支持多主和双向支持 | 单向复制 整个Oracle数据库 |
3 | 限制 | 不支持XML和blob等数据类型。 | 无限制 |
4 | 备份透明度 | 仅复制的数据彼此相似。它没有备份透明度。 | 在Oracle Data Guard中,主库和备库是彼此的物理精确副本。 |
5 | 性能 | 无性能影响 | 如果表没有主键,则会影响性能 |
广告